Game Boy Advance

Game Boy Advance

The Game Boy Advance was released in 2001 and was a portable follow-up to the Game Boy line boasting 16-bit graphics and sound. The system was redesigned as the Game Boy Advance SP in 2003 with a new look clamshell design, rechargable battery, and backlit screen. In 2005, a third iteration, the miniscule Game Boy micro was released.


Release Details

System Japan USA Europe
Game Boy Advance 21 March 2001 11 June 2001 22 June 2001
Game Boy Advance SP 14 February 2003 23 March 2003 28 March 2003
Game Boy Micro 13 September 2005 19 September 2005 4 November 2005
